td#menu {padding: 0;}
#mainmenuWrap {padding: 3px; float: left;width: 454px;}
#mainmenu {margin: 0 0 10px 0; float: left;  width: 100%; }
#mainmenu ul {float: left; margin: 0; padding: 0}
#mainmenu li {margin: 0; padding: 0; display: inline; float:left; list-style: none; background:none; font-size: 13px; font-weight:bold; text-align: center}
#mainmenu li a {padding: 7px 13px; background:#a08a7d; color: #fff;  display:block; }
#mainmenu li a:hover {text-decoration: underline}
#mainmenu li.on a { text-decoration: none; color: #3a261e; background: #ece5db;}
#mainmenu li#home {width: 90px;}
#mainmenu li#markets {clear: right;width: 147px;}
#mainmenu li#order {clear: left; width: 95px;}
#mainmenu li#contact {width: 96px;}

/*slightly different styling for the non-blog pages - it's a quick fix, sorry!*/
td#menu #mainmenuWrap {padding: 0; width: 461px; }
td#menu #mainmenu {margin: 0}
td#menu #mainmenu li#home {width: 94px;}
td#menu #mainmenu li#markets {width: 151px;}
td#menu #mainmenu li#order {width: 99px;}
td#menu #mainmenu li#contact {width: 100px;}